DWI Clients - Alcohol and Drug Treatment Programs - Goodsprings, AL.

DWI clients in rehab need to complete specific requirements to satisfy the conditions of their court sentencing. Treatment facilities that help fulfill these court requirements and terms, which are typically far more lenient than traditional sentencing such as heavy fines and incarceration, are offered in Goodsprings to deliver educational services, therapy, and further assessment for individuals with heavy substance abuse issues.

Drug and Alcohol Education is an essential treatment tool used at rehab programs catering to DWI clients. There are various levels of alcohol education classes and this can differ by state. Level I education classes typically consist of 12 hours of group education related to the effects and dangers of drugs and/or alcohol. This is the what a person with a first offense or someone under the age of 21 will often be required to complete. Level II courses would include both education and therapy in a program which is approved by the courts. How long a person will be required to remain in therapy depends upon various factors, which can be, for example, how many DWI's the person has had, and the seriousness of the violation. Ordinarily, clients will be required to take the Level II classes and therapy except for when their blood-alcohol content was extremely low when they were stopped and there were no other serious infractions when the person was arrested.
